PatternExamination of the zag-1::ZAG-1-GFP(zdIs39) strain revealed relatively faint GFP expression in neuronal nuclei from mid to late embryogenesis and during the L1 stage. Widespread expression was seen in head and tail regions containing differentiating neurons beginning around the comma stage that diminished as embryogenesis continued. Expression remained in a few neurons at hatching and was typically nonexistent by midlarval stages. Transient expression was also detected in the postembryonic Pn.a neuroblasts and their descendants during the L1. Thus, zag-1 is expressed transiently in most or all neurons during embryogenesis and in the Pn.a-derived ventral cord neurons during the L1.
